News Summary

A Los Angeles jury awarded delivery driver Michael Garcia $50 million after he suffered severe burns from a hot drink at a Starbucks drive-through. The incident occurred in February 2020 when a cup of hot tea slipped from a tray, causing third-degree burns to sensitive areas. Garcia underwent multiple surgeries and is seeking accountability from Starbucks, which plans to appeal the verdict. This case raises concerns about customer safety and has drawn comparisons to other famous lawsuits involving hot beverages.

Big Win for Delivery Driver Facing Severe Burns from Starbucks Drink

In a jaw-dropping verdict from a Los Angeles County jury, delivery driver Michael Garcia has been awarded a whopping $50 million after suffering devastating injuries from an unsecured drink at a Starbucks drive-through. This surprising decision has left many talking, and we’re diving into what went down.

The Incident That Changed Everything

The incident happened on February 8, 2020, when Garcia was busy doing his job for Postmates. He pulled up to a Starbucks drive-through and picked up three Venti-sized “Medicine Ball” hot teas. Little did he know, this seemingly ordinary task would turn into a nightmare.

After receiving his drinks from a barista, one of the cups slipped away from the takeout tray and landed in Garcia’s lap. This split-second accident led to third-degree burns on sensitive areas including his penis, groin, and inner thighs. What Went Wrong?

The crux of the lawsuit pointed a finger at Starbucks, claiming that the barista “negligently failed” to secure the drink properly in the takeout tray. Oh, how quickly things can go wrong! Surveillance footage even backs this up, showing the unfortunate cup falling into Garcia’s lap just 1.4 seconds after he had taken possession of it. Yikes!

The Long Road to Recovery

As a result of those nasty burns, Garcia underwent multiple skin graft surgeries and has been dealing with a lot more than physical pain. Over the past five years, he has encountered both significant physical and psychological harm. Adjustments to one’s life following such injuries can be immense, both for the body and the mind. Starbucks Responds

In response to the jury’s ruling, Starbucks announced their intention to appeal the decision, calling the damages awarded excessive. The corporate giant maintains a stance that disagrees with the jury’s determination of fault but insists on upholding its high safety standards in handling hot beverages.

Before heading to trial, Starbucks had offered Garcia a settlement of $3 million, which they later increased to $30 million. However, these offers came with confidentiality agreements that Garcia chose to refuse. He wanted more than just money; he wanted the chance for a public apology and meaningful changes in Starbucks policies to help ensure no one else goes through a similar ordeal.

A Familiar Tale?

This case has drawn comparisons to other well-known lawsuits, like that infamous 1994 McDonald’s coffee burn lawsuit. Just like the Starbucks situation, it raised concerns over the safety of hot beverages. Interestingly, Starbucks has faced multiple lawsuits related to injuries from hot drinks, suggesting this might not be an isolated incident.

The Lasting Impact

Garcia’s attorney highlighted that these injuries have led to permanent changes in his life, including ongoing pain and psychological effects such as PTSD.
